The Leisure & Activities Coordinator will need to design, develop and implement individual and group activities across the home to residents, by understanding who the residents are including their identity, culture, diversity, beliefs and life experiences. Location: Brooklea is our 28 bed supported residential service facility located in Donvale. 355 Springvale Road, Donvale, Vic 3111 The successful applicant will need: Certificate IV Leisure & Lifestyle or other relevant qualification. Current First Aid Certificate. Experience in the planning, implementation and evaluation of activities and programmes for frail people with cognitive impairment and other disabilities. Ability to document assessments, care plans and progress notes to meet legislative, funding and quality improvement requirements, Current VIC Driver’s License. High level of honesty and integrity. Ability to understand and use information technology and programs and to learn new skills as required. Your main duties will include: Care planning, design and develop group and 1:1 care programs for residents that takes into account their individual lifestyle, hobbies and spiritual needs. Design and plan individual activities aligned to resident interests and needs that can be carried out by the care team. Through activity, promoting close relationships with families and carers for the health and wellbeing of residents. Liaise with family members and assess the needs, preferences and capabilities of each Resident to compile appropriate individual activity assessments and care plans.
